Colonic organoids and methods of making and using same

Disclosed herein are methods for the in vitro differentiation of a precursor cell into definitive endoderm, which may further be differentiated into a human colonic organoid (HCO), via modulation of signaling pathways. Further disclosed are HCOs and methods of using HCOs, which may be used, for example, for the HCOs may be used to determine the efficacy and/or toxicity of a potential therapeutic agent for a disease selected from colitis, colon cancer, polyposis syndromes, and/or irritable bowel syndrome.

Isolated human lung progenitor cells and uses thereof

Provided herein are methods and compositions relating, in part, to the generation of human progenitor cells committed to the lung lineage and uses of such cells for treatment of lung diseases/disorders or injury to the lung. Whether an adult stem cell can be isolated from human adult lung remains controversial in the art and at present, methods for isolating and using adult lung stem cells from humans lack reproducibility. Thus, the methods and compositions described herein are advantageous over the present state of knowledge in the art and permit the generation of human lung progenitor cells for treatment, tissue engineering, and screening assays.

Method for cultivating primary human pulmonary alveolar epithelial cells and application thereof

Disclosed herein is a method for cultivating primary human pulmonary alveolar epithelial cells (HPAEpiC), which includes cultivating the primary HPAEpiC in a first medium containing a basal medium, a culture supplement, and a Rho kinase inhibitor, and a second medium containing the basal medium and the culture supplement in sequence. The culture supplement includes Jagged-1 (JAG-1) peptide, human Noggin protein, transforming growth factor-β (TGF-β) type I receptor inhibitor SB431542, human fibroblast growth factor 7 (hFGF-7), hFGF-10, and glycogen synthase kinase 3 (GSK-3) inhibitor CHIR99021. Also disclosed is a method for preparing a three-dimensional cell culture of alveolar epithelium using the first medium and the second medium.
